An Earth Without the Luna
Imagine the planet where Earth spins without its familiar companion. Tides would be dramatically reduced , eliminating the regular rise and fall that molds coastal habitats. The planetary tilt of Earth would possibly experience more fluctuation over geological timescales, leading to harsh seasonal changes and perhaps rendering some regions difficult for organisms. Rotations might be somewhat shorter, and the want of the Moon's gravitational would also change the Earth’s internal behavior, potentially causing frequent volcanic eruptions and shifting the Earth’s surface . Ultimately , Earth without the Moon would be a fundamentally transformed world.
